HANDOVER — Wellness Room, Ferncote Site

From day shift: Room 3 booking system (Calmbook) was glitchy this morning; two double-bookings, both resolved. Tell anyone asking that slots after 18:00 are blocked for deep clean tonight. New yoga mats arrived — stored in the corridor cupboard, not the room. One booking outstanding: 19:30, approved as an exception; let them in manually. Door code for tonight is below — changes again at 06:00.

door code, kawip-bagap: bdg-HQEWH-4

**Ticket: Vault sealed — Mailgrate bounce processor**

Mailgrate's secrets vault sealed after the host rebooted unexpectedly. Bounce classification is halted; queues are growing. Maintainers: unseal via the standby node, verify token lease renewal, then restart the classifier workers. Document the timeline in this ticket. The recovery passphrase required for the unseal procedure is recorded below.

unlock words, kagef-taduf: fenir-quenix-norwyn-sorvan-gormir-gorir-fraok

Ticket DRV-907 — Signature verification failure, driver-assignment heuristic bundle

The Routewise dispatcher rejects the v3.4 heuristic bundle with a signature mismatch. Root cause: the bundle was built on the Kellerman CI runner after its trust store was rotated, but the dispatcher still validates against the old chain. Future maintainers: always confirm the dispatcher's trusted key matches the CI signer before shipping heuristics. The key the dispatcher expects is recorded here for verification purposes.

rollout seal: bky4_x7Gc

Notice for plugin authors: the Kestrelfall crash-report pipeline was dropping symbolicated reports from third-party modules in CI. Root cause was a mismatch between the symbol-upload step and the dSYM naming convention introduced in the latest toolchain. The pipeline now normalizes names before matching, so no plugin-side changes are required. If your reports still arrive unsymbolicated, rebuild against the pipeline version shown below.

trace token, bagag-fahag: htk21_1a5003b533f7b0cca4331